Active Myofascial Release

Active myofascial release is a soft tissue technique that treats problems with muscles, tendons, ligaments, fascia, and nerves (collectively called soft tissue).

 

The doctors at White Mountain Chiropractic and Rehabilitation will use their hands to evaluate the texture, tightness, adhesions (scar tissue) and restrictions of these soft tissues. Abnormal tissues are treated by combining precise pressure or tension with specific movements performed by the patient. This myofascial release targets the dysfunctional areas and is used to break it up and free up the soft tissue. The specific contact, tension, and patient movement set active myofascial release apart from other passive soft tissue techniques.

Active Myofascial Release is effective at treating injuries including:

  • Back and Neck Pain

  • Headaches

  • Knee Injuries

  • Shoulder Pain (Rotator Cuff)

  • Tennis and Golfer’s Elbow

  • Plantar Fasciitis

  • Carpal Tunnel Syndrome
